In Sync: Full Ball Puzzle is a clever spatial reasoning game that will test your brain. The premise is simple: move one ball, and all other balls on the screen move in the same direction. It’s a classic 'synchronous movement' puzzle that starts easy but quickly becomes a complex dance of maneuvering balls around walls and through narrow corridors.

The level design is excellent, introducing new mechanics like one-way gates and color-coded targets at a steady pace. It’s visually minimalist, which helps you focus on the logic of the puzzle. If you enjoy games like 'Sokoban' or 'Baba Is You,' this provides a similar type of mental workout. It’s satisfying to solve a particularly tricky level where the solution finally 'clicks' into place.

Control two balls in sync. Guide them towards their goals without hitting too many traps or falling off the path. Super fun & challenging.

Unique puzzle game, easy to learn, fun to play, and a perfect source of entertainment during free time and commute time.

The game is designed to be enjoyed by newcomers and returning players alike. It is completely ad-free, has no in-app payments, and provides a fun experience for the players without interruptions.

Spend your time going balls with balls and have fun.

Features

• 100 unique 3D levels, with 300 total points to collect.

• Easy, one-finger swipe balls control.

• Offline, single-user game.

• Easy, Medium, and Hard modes.

• Race against the clock in Medium and Hard modes.

• No ads. No in-app payments.

• With iCloud support. Start playing on your iPhone, and continue on your iPad.

• Play this game with your favorite compatible controller.

• Lots of fun.


Requires iOS 12.0 or later. Compatible with iPhone, iPad, and iPod touch.
